Output e2b657988b05165d423b84a882a53064acde3d54120391191663277fba8d8e29:1

value
681672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c15c5e9f436b5327fc235a6e974960b265f3c8 OP_EQUAL
address
3MYQC7h59ga7DAd7hvgTXZLHqcWTjhVDQv
transaction
e2b657988b05165d423b84a882a53064acde3d54120391191663277fba8d8e29
spent
true